معرفی فایل STL و OBJ

در دنیای پرینتر سه‌ بعدی، اولین گام برای تولید یک مدل فیزیکی، داشتن یک فایل سه‌بعدی است. این فایل‌ها به عنوان نقشه‌ای برای پرینتر سه‌بعدی عمل می‌کنند و به دستگاه دستور می‌دهند که چگونه هر لایه از ماده را اضافه کرده و مدل مورد نظر را ایجاد کند. برای ایجاد این فایل‌ها، از فرمت‌های مختلفی استفاده می‌شود که هرکدام ویژگی‌ها و کاربردهای مخصوص به خود را دارند.

دو نوع از محبوب‌ترین فرمت‌های فایل سه‌بعدی که در صنعت چاپ سه‌بعدی استفاده می‌شوند، STL و OBJ هستند. این فرمت‌ها به طور گسترده برای طراحی مدل‌های سه‌ بعدی و آماده‌ سازی آن‌ها برای چاپ سه‌ بعدی مورد استفاده قرار می‌گیرند. اما هر کدام از این فرمت‌ ها ساختار، ویژگی‌ها و قابلیت‌های منحصر به فرد خود را دارند، که باعث می‌شود برای کاربردهای خاصی مناسب‌تر باشند.

در ادامه این مقاله، ما به معرفی دقیق این دو فرمت، ویژگی‌ها و کاربردهای هر یک، و تفاوت‌های مهم میان آن‌ها میپردازیم.

فرمت STL چیست؟

در فایل‌های STL، مدل سه‌ بعدی از طریق تعداد زیادی مثلث کوچک تشکیل می‌شود. هر یک از این مثلث‌ها سطح کوچکی از مدل را پوشش می‌دهد، و وقتی همه مثلث‌ ها کنار هم قرار می‌گیرند، شکل کلی مدل ساخته می‌شود.

این فرمت فقط داده‌ های هندسی سطح را ذخیره می‌کند و اطلاعاتی مانند رنگ، بافت، یا خواص مادی را شامل نمی‌شود. به دلیل ساختار ساده‌ اش، فایل‌های STL معمولاً حجم کمی دارند و پردازش آن‌ ها توسط پرینترهای سه‌ بعدی سریع و آسان است.

این ساختار مثلثی ساده یکی از دلایلی است که فرمت STL به‌طور گسترده در چاپ سه‌بعدی استفاده می‌شود. مثلث‌ ها شکل‌ های هندسی ساده‌ ای هستند که پردازش آن‌ها برای نرم‌افزارهای طراحی و پرینترهای سه‌ بعدی آسان است.

دقت یک فایل STL به تعداد مثلث‌ هایی که برای نمایش مدل استفاده می‌شود، بستگی دارد. هر چه تعداد مثلث‌ ها بیشتر باشد، جزئیات بیشتری در مدل نمایش داده می‌شود، اما حجم فایل نیز افزایش می‌یابد.

مزایا: ساده و قابل استفاده برای بسیاری از نرم‌افزارهای چاپ سه‌ بعدی، حجم فایل کوچک و پردازش سریع.

معایب: عدم پشتیبانی از اطلاعات رنگ و بافت، محدودیت در نمایش جزئیات پیچیده و امکان ایجاد اشکالات هندسی در مدل‌های پیچیده.

کاربردها:

فرمت STL به طور گسترده‌ای در چاپ سه‌ بعدی، به ویژه در فرآیندهای پروتوتایپ‌سازی سریع، مورد استفاده قرار می‌گیرد. از آنجا که این فرمت به خوبی با اکثر پرینترهای سه‌ بعدی سازگار است، در بسیاری از صنایع مانند مهندسی، پزشکی، و ساخت محصولات مصرفی مورد استفاده قرار می‌گیرد. برای مدل‌هایی که نیاز به رنگ یا بافت ندارند، STL انتخاب مناسبی است.

فرمت OBJ چیست

فرمت OBJ یک فرمت فایل سه‌ بعدی است که این فرمت به دلیل قابلیت‌های گسترده‌اش در ذخیره‌سازی اطلاعات سه‌ بعدی، از جمله رنگ‌ ها و بافت‌ ها، به سرعت در میان طراحان سه‌ بعدی محبوب شد. برخلاف STL، فرمت OBJ یک فرمت متنی است و از ساختار ساده‌ ای برای ذخیره داده‌های سه‌ بعدی استفاده می‌کند.

فایل‌های OBJ علاوه بر اطلاعات هندسی سطح، می‌توانند اطلاعات پیچیده‌تری مانند رنگ‌ها، نورپردازی، و بافت‌های مختلف را نیز ذخیره کنند. این ویژگی‌ها باعث می‌شود که فایل‌های OBJ برای پروژه‌هایی که نیاز به جزئیات و دقت بالایی دارند، مناسب باشند.

فایل‌های OBJ شامل یک سری چندضلعی هستند که می‌توانند سطوح صاف یا منحنی را به صورت دقیق‌تری نسبت به STL نمایش دهند. این فرمت همچنین از نور UV برای اعمال بافت‌ها و رنگ‌ها بر روی مدل استفاده می‌کند.

مزایا: قابلیت‌های گسترده در ذخیره‌سازی اطلاعات پیچیده، مناسب برای پروژه‌های هنری و مدل‌های با جزئیات بالا.

معایب: حجم بالای فایل به دلیل ذخیره‌سازی داده‌های بیشتر، نیاز به پردازش و محاسبات بیشتر، و در برخی موارد، ناسازگاری با برخی نرم‌افزارهای چاپ سه‌بعدی ساده.

کاربردها:

فرمت OBJ به دلیل قابلیت‌های گرافیکی قوی‌اش، در صنایع مختلفی مانند بازی‌سازی، فیلم‌سازی، طراحی صنعتی و معماری بسیار مورد استفاده قرار می‌گیرد. این فرمت به خصوص در پروژه‌هایی که نیاز به نمایش دقیق جزئیات، رنگ‌ها و بافت‌های متنوع دارند، کاربرد دارد. همچنین در پروژه‌هایی که مدل‌ها باید در نرم‌افزارهای مختلف ویرایش شوند، OBJ به دلیل ساختار متنی و قابل خواندنش بسیار مفید است.

 

مقایسه فرمت‌های STL و OBJ

فرمت STL از یک شبکه مثلثی برای نمایش سطوح خارجی مدل‌ها استفاده می‌کند، در حالی که OBJ از چندضلعی‌ها (که می‌توانند تعداد بیشتری راس داشته باشند) بهره می‌برد. این باعث می‌شود OBJ توانایی نمایش سطوح پیچیده‌تری داشته باشد. علاوه بر این، STL فقط شامل داده‌های هندسی است، در حالی که OBJ می‌تواند داده‌های مرتبط با رنگ، بافت و نورپردازی را نیز ذخیره کند

کاربردها:

اگر هدف شما چاپ سه‌بعدی ساده و سریع است و نیاز به جزئیات یا رنگ‌های پیچیده ندارید، فرمت STL انتخاب مناسبی است. از سوی دیگر، اگر به دنبال طراحی مدل‌های با جزئیات بالا و نیاز به استفاده از بافت‌ها و رنگ‌های دقیق هستید، فرمت OBJ گزینه بهتری خواهد بود.

سازگاری با نرم‌افزارها:

هر دو فرمت STL و OBJ با اکثر نرم‌افزارهای طراحی و چاپ سه‌بعدی سازگار هستند، اما برخی نرم‌افزارهای ساده‌تر ممکن است با ویژگی‌های پیچیده OBJ مانند بافت‌ها و رنگ‌ها سازگاری نداشته باشند. به علاوه، حجم بالاتر فایل‌های OBJ می‌تواند در برخی موارد باعث کاهش کارایی نرم‌افزارها شود.

کدام فرمت برای شما مناسب‌ تر است

راه‌ اندازی کسب‌ و کار در حوزه فیگور سازی با پرینتر سه‌ بعدی، یک فرصت جذاب و رو به رشد برای افرادی است که به طراحی، هنر، و تکنولوژی علاقه دارند. این صنعت به دلیل قابلیت‌های گسترده پرینترهای سه‌ بعدی، از شخصی‌سازی فیگورها تا تولید انبوه محصولات منحصر به فرد، می‌تواند منبع درآمد پرسودی باشد. برای راه‌ اندازی موفق یک کسب‌ و کار در این حوزه، باید به چندین عامل کلیدی توجه کرد.

نتیجه گیری

در این مقاله، دو فرمت محبوب STL و OBJ را بررسی کردیم و به ویژگی‌ها، کاربردها و تفاوت‌های آن‌ها پرداختیم. هر کدام از این فرمت‌ها بسته به نیازهای پروژه‌های مختلف، مزایا و معایب خاص خود را دارند. با در نظر گرفتن ویژگی‌های هر فرمت و نیازهای خاص پروژه خود، می‌توانید بهترین انتخاب را برای رسیدن به نتایج مطلوب داشته باشید.

سایر راهکار ها

سایر موارد

دیدگاه‌ خود را بنویسید

آنچه در این مقاله می خوانید

سبد خرید